双向DCDC变换器模拟与设计-Matlab实现
版权申诉
5星 · 超过95%的资源 144 浏览量
更新于2024-10-28
2
收藏 11KB ZIP 举报
资源摘要信息:"biDCDC.zip_DCDC Matlab_双向_双向 boost_双向 buck-boost_双向buck-boost"
在电子工程领域,DC-DC转换器是一种在直流电源之间进行电压转换的电子电路。DC-DC转换器的主要功能是在不中断负载的情况下调整电压的大小,从而提高能量效率或适应不同的电子设备的电源需求。DC-DC转换器的应用极为广泛,包括但不限于移动设备、汽车电子、可再生能源系统、不间断电源(UPS)等。
DC-DC转换器的主要类型有:升压(Boost)、降压(Buck)、升降压(Buck-Boost)以及双向DC-DC转换器(bi-directional DC-DC, biDCDC)。双向DC-DC转换器具有同时进行升压和降压操作的能力,这使得它们在需要能量双向流动的应用场合中特别有用,例如在电动车的再生制动系统、储能系统、以及某些需要能量回流的电源管理系统中。
双向DC-DC转换器的工作原理:
1. 升压模式:在升压模式下,双向DC-DC转换器像传统的升压转换器一样工作,即输出电压大于输入电压。通过适当的控制策略,可以实现能量从低电压侧向高电压侧传递。
2. 降压模式:在降压模式下,转换器操作与传统的降压转换器类似,输出电压小于输入电压,能量从高电压侧流向低电压侧。
3. 控制策略:双向DC-DC转换器的关键在于其控制策略,通常使用脉宽调制(PWM)技术来控制开关元件(例如MOSFET或IGBT)的通断,从而调节能量流动的方向和大小,以达到所需的电压转换。
在Matlab环境中,可以通过Simulink模块库搭建模拟电路,对DC-DC转换器进行动态建模和仿真。Matlab/Simulink是一种强大的工程仿真和模型设计软件,广泛应用于控制设计、信号处理、通信系统、图像处理等工程领域。
在这个上下文中,文件"biDCDC.zip_DCDC Matlab_双向_双向 boost_双向 buck-boost_双向buck-boost"可能包含了用于Matlab/Simulink的模拟模型,它被命名为"biDCDC.mdl"。该模型将允许工程师或研究者模拟和测试双向DC-DC转换器在不同工作模式下的性能,包括升压、降压以及升降压操作。
通过这个模型,用户能够进行以下操作:
- 调整和优化控制算法,以改善转换效率和稳定性。
- 模拟不同的负载条件和电源波动对转换器性能的影响。
- 观察和分析波形,包括电压、电流以及功率的动态响应。
- 在设计和开发阶段验证转换器的性能指标。
双向DC-DC转换器的仿真模型对于从事电源系统设计和优化工作的工程师来说是非常有用的工具。它能够在实际制造和测试之前对电路进行详尽的分析,从而节省时间和成本。此外,由于它是在Matlab/Simulink平台上构建的,因此还可以与Matlab的其他工具箱(如控制系统工具箱、优化工具箱等)集成,为用户提供了更多的分析和设计选项。
120 浏览量
2022-07-15 上传
194 浏览量
141 浏览量
130 浏览量
2022-09-20 上传
2022-07-15 上传
268 浏览量
608 浏览量
朱moyimi
- 粉丝: 82
- 资源: 1万+
最新资源
- mouritsen2011:发现Kim N. Mouritsen,Robert Poulin,John P. McLaughlin和David W. Thieltges中的交互数据。 2011。食物网,包括新西兰潮间带生态系统的后生寄生虫。 生态学92:2006
- wormsGame:编码游戏练习
- ft_printf
- RESTAURANT-DISCOVERY-APP
- 企业面临的问题
- helios-skydns:用于Helios的SkyDNS注册器插件
- DroneProject
- 人工智能在5G通信领域上的发展探究.zip
- katrinadelorenzo:轮廓
- 企业不良资产评价与操作
- koa-knex-hrm:使用koa ang knex的HRM后端
- harmonyos2-turtlewax:使用HTML5Canvas在JavaScript中绘制徽标样式的海龟图形。基本上,海龟图形是为Jav
- SO-23
- 在Java中,Scanner类.zip
- 大气简洁动物类网站模板是一款野生动物展示的css网站模板下载 .rar
- technical-documentation-page:FreeCodeCamp的技术文档页面项目